Biography

Prof. Chang-Sik Ha

Pusan National University, South Korea


Email: csha@pnu.edu


Qualifications


1987 Ph.D., Polymer Physics and Engineering, KAIST

1980 M.S., Korea Advanced Institute of Science and Technology [KAIST]

1978 B.S., Chemical Engineering, PNU
